Anti-inflammatory Powerhouse:

One of the most well-known and extensively studied benefits of turmeric is its potent anti-inflammatory properties. Curcumin, the active compound in turmeric, acts as a powerful antioxidant and inhibits the activity of inflammatory enzymes in the body. This makes turmeric a natural and effective remedy for reducing inflammation associated with conditions like arthritis, joint pain, and even chronic diseases such as heart disease and cancer.




Enhanced Brain Function:

Turmeric has been hailed as a brain-boosting spice that may help promote cognitive function and protect against age-related brain disorders. Curcumin has been found to cross the blood-brain barrier, where it exerts its neuroprotective effects. It helps to reduce oxidative stress, inflammation, and the accumulation of amyloid plaques, which are characteristic of conditions like Alzheimer's disease. Including turmeric in your diet could potentially support brain health and improve memory and overall cognitive performance.

Heart Health Support:

Maintaining a healthy heart is crucial for overall well-being, and turmeric can play a significant role in supporting cardiovascular health. Research suggests that curcumin can improve endothelial function, reduce blood clot formation, lower cholesterol levels, and reduce oxidative stress—all factors that contribute to heart disease. By incorporating turmeric into your diet, you may reduce the risk of developing heart conditions and promote a healthier cardiovascular system.




Digestive Aid and Gut Health:

Turmeric has long been used in traditional medicine to promote healthy digestion. It stimulates the production of bile, a substance essential for the breakdown of fats and the absorption of nutrients. Furthermore, turmeric's anti-inflammatory properties can help soothe gastrointestinal inflammation and alleviate symptoms of conditions such as ir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) and ulcerative colitis. By incorporating turmeric into your meals, you can support a healthy digestive system and maintain optimal gut health.

Powerful Antioxidant:

Turmeric's rich yellow color is attributed to its high antioxidant content, which helps combat free radicals and oxidative stress in the body. Curcumin's antioxidant properties make it an effective shield against cellular damage, thus potentially reducing the risk of chronic diseases and premature aging. By including turmeric in your diet or incorporating it into your skincare routine, you can harness its powerful antioxidant effects for a healthier and more youthful you.
